Title :
Novel approach for knowledge-based evolutionary parameter tuning for controllers

Abstract :
There are three types of parameter tuning for controllers: start-up, on-demand and evolutionary. This paper proposes a novel approach of knowledge-based evolutionary parameter tuning for controllers. First, a knowledge-based system is developed for online pattern recognition of transient responses of feedback control systems. Then, iteration of controller parameters is formulated as a quasi-LQR (linear quadratic regulator) problem. A set of rules are designed to supervise the embedded utilization of solution to the quasi-LQR. Effectiveness of the proposed approach is demonstrated by simulations
